Home
last modified time | relevance | path

Searched refs:AsyncInvoker (Results 1 – 8 of 8) sorted by relevance

/external/webrtc/webrtc/base/
Dasyncinvoker.cc18 AsyncInvoker::AsyncInvoker() : destroying_(false) {} in AsyncInvoker() function in rtc::AsyncInvoker
20 AsyncInvoker::~AsyncInvoker() { in ~AsyncInvoker()
27 void AsyncInvoker::OnMessage(Message* msg) { in OnMessage()
39 void AsyncInvoker::Flush(Thread* thread, uint32_t id /*= MQID_ANY*/) { in Flush()
44 thread->Invoke<void>(Bind(&AsyncInvoker::Flush, this, thread, id)); in Flush()
58 void AsyncInvoker::DoInvoke(Thread* thread, in DoInvoke()
68 void AsyncInvoker::DoInvokeDelayed(Thread* thread, in DoInvokeDelayed()
103 NotifyingAsyncClosureBase::NotifyingAsyncClosureBase(AsyncInvoker* invoker, in NotifyingAsyncClosureBase()
Dasyncinvoker-inl.h25 class AsyncInvoker; variable
61 NotifyingAsyncClosureBase(AsyncInvoker* invoker, Thread* calling_thread);
72 AsyncInvoker* invoker_;
82 NotifyingAsyncClosure(AsyncInvoker* invoker, in NotifyingAsyncClosure()
110 NotifyingAsyncClosure(AsyncInvoker* invoker, in NotifyingAsyncClosure()
Dasyncinvoker.h69 class AsyncInvoker : public MessageHandler {
71 AsyncInvoker();
72 ~AsyncInvoker() override;
143 RTC_DISALLOW_COPY_AND_ASSIGN(AsyncInvoker);
224 AsyncInvoker invoker_ GUARDED_BY(crit_);
Dthread_unittest.cc360 AsyncInvoker invoker; in TEST()
386 void AsyncInvokeIntCallback(AsyncInvoker* invoker, Thread* thread) { in AsyncInvokeIntCallback()
410 AsyncInvoker invoker; in TEST_F()
421 AsyncInvoker invoker; in TEST_F()
439 AsyncInvoker invoker; in TEST_F()
450 AsyncInvoker invoker; in TEST_F()
470 AsyncInvoker invoker; in TEST_F()
484 AsyncInvoker invoker; in TEST_F()
502 AsyncInvoker invoker; in TEST_F()
/external/webrtc/talk/media/webrtc/
Dwebrtcvideocapturer.h103 rtc::scoped_ptr<rtc::AsyncInvoker> async_invoker_;
Dwebrtcvideocapturer.cc296 async_invoker_.reset(new rtc::AsyncInvoker()); in Start()
/external/webrtc/webrtc/p2p/base/
Dturnport.h133 rtc::AsyncInvoker* invoker() { return &invoker_; } in invoker()
278 rtc::AsyncInvoker invoker_;
/external/webrtc/webrtc/p2p/stunprober/
Dstunprober.h240 rtc::AsyncInvoker invoker_;